CTI - WTG-161

Consensus Cooling System Performance Guidelines

active, Most Current
Organization: CTI
Publication Date: 1 March 2023
Status: active
Page Count: 22
scope:

These consensus guidelines provide Basic Practice and State of the Art (SOTA) performance targets for open evaporative cooling water systems in a broad range of industry applications.

There is no universal "one size fits all" set of guidelines because cooling systems vary widely in the materials of construction, equipment, operation and water quality. Users should apply these guidelines as part of the decision-making process, in conjunction with recommendations from their equipment suppliers, water treatment chemistry providers, and consultants. The scope of this document does not include specification limits for water quality parameters or chemical treatment products and concentrations.

Purpose

The purpose of this document is to provide consensus guidelines on cooling water system program performance to plant owners and operators and their suppliers and consultants. The guidelines facilitate a thorough assessment of the performance of their current cooling water treatment programs and provide a basis for contract performance specifications.
